Sha256: 4f20e670ca3e9e77ee191b761e5d13c1225864af908e74961b669aff5aedfde7

Contents?: true

Size: 248 Bytes

Versions: 9

Compression:

Stored size: 248 Bytes

Contents

/// Marker for types that are `Sync` but not `Send`
#[allow(dead_code)]
pub(crate) struct SyncNotSend(#[allow(dead_code)] *mut ());

unsafe impl Sync for SyncNotSend {}

cfg_rt! {
    pub(crate) struct NotSendOrSync(#[allow(dead_code)] *mut ());
}

Version data entries

9 entries across 9 versions & 1 rubygems

Version Path
wasmtime-30.0.2 ./ext/cargo-vendor/tokio-1.43.0/src/util/markers.rs
wasmtime-29.0.0 ./ext/cargo-vendor/tokio-1.43.0/src/util/markers.rs
wasmtime-28.0.0 ./ext/cargo-vendor/tokio-1.43.0/src/util/markers.rs
wasmtime-27.0.0 ./ext/cargo-vendor/tokio-1.41.1/src/util/markers.rs
wasmtime-26.0.0 ./ext/cargo-vendor/tokio-1.41.0/src/util/markers.rs
wasmtime-25.0.2 ./ext/cargo-vendor/tokio-1.40.0/src/util/markers.rs
wasmtime-25.0.1 ./ext/cargo-vendor/tokio-1.39.3/src/util/markers.rs
wasmtime-25.0.0 ./ext/cargo-vendor/tokio-1.39.3/src/util/markers.rs
wasmtime-24.0.0 ./ext/cargo-vendor/tokio-1.39.3/src/util/markers.rs